Take a look at the paint for runs or blemishes such as hair or flecks of dust caught in the surface. Scratches on screws that happened while the automobile was being fixed need to be provided a repair. There are particular things that an automobile body shop need to do after the repair services are done which might not also be associated with the repair services themselves.

After the body repair service, your cars and truck should be washed, cleaned and vacuumed. Looks are necessary. There should be no dirt or dust in the car neither should there be old parts in the trunk. Car body shops are very filthy places and your car will absolutely obtain dirty in the process yet it need to not be gone back to you in such a condition.

The parts they used requirement to be detailed in a list not simply for your advantage however, for the purpose of your insurer. Couple of months after the repair service, you require to examine whether your front tires are wearing erratically. If they are, this is a sign that the front suspension has not been corrected the alignment of and repaired correctly There are a number of points that most body stores will not tell you due to the fact that knowing the fact might prevent you from utilizing their services.

A small dent repair or a fast bumper touch-up can often be concluded within 1 to 2 days. If your vehicle's obtained heavier damage like a bent-up framework, banged-up panels, or it's been with a severe collision, you're probably looking at something like 7 to 14 days. Possibly much more.

Components schedule is a big factor. Oh, and don't forget insurance coverage approvals. If the store's already packed when your vehicle shows up, that includes a little wait time.

Parts go missing. Simply remain cool and flexible Range Vehicle believes in craftsmanship, treatment, and communication. As one of the most trusted, we bring years of hands-on experience and cutting edge devices to every fixing.

Everything relies on the damages, components, and just how hectic the shop is. Ask for a ballpark once they inspect it, yet stay versatile. They usually need added images, documentation, or authorizations before job can begin. Some relocate fast, others do not. Ideal thing? Get your stuff in early and follow up.

Whether you were just in a mishap or are in the middle of looking for a vehicle body shop, it helps to understand the auto mishap repair process. Keep reading for a step-by-step overview, professional tips, cases and protection information, Frequently asked questions and more! Points initially: Obtain out of the way of other traffic if you're physically able to.



The responding police officer will certainly put together an accident record, which you may need to provide to your insurance policy business. This includes: All lorries entailed in the accident Climate conditions Road conditions Illumination on the roadway Any kind of physical injuries you have If the accident entailed another driver, you should trade insurance coverage and contact information.

Your insurer might offer a list of recommended shops where you can take your automobile for repair services, but you are not required to follow their suggestions. You can select a car body shop that you're comfy with, or look for one in your area. Whatever route you select, ensure your car body store uses the following: Free, quick price quotes I-CAR certified technicians Life time limited warranty for all fixings A thorough high quality control procedure Every auto body repair service shop is various, and the degree of the repair work procedure will rely on the severity of your vehicle's damage.

This will give you a concept of the level of the damage and the prospective price of repair services. Insurance Authorization: The auto body store will certainly send the price quote to your insurer. There may be some back and forth here, however you shouldn't be as well included with this action. Dropoff: Once the vehicle service center has an approved estimate, you'll bring your lorry in for repair work.

Order Parts: Once there's a blueprint, replacement components will certainly be gotten. This involves coordination with the insurance provider so as to get the best parts at the most effective rate. Fixings: This covers all architectural and mechanical repair work. In most circumstances, this step can begin before the new components arrive. Paint: A brand-new layer of paint helps bring back automobiles back to their factory surface.
